Playa del Carmen Travel: Key Items & What to Avoid
Planning a trip to Playa del Carmen? Remember to pack lightly . Definitely bring biodegradable sunscreen, a large hat, mosquito repellent, and a sturdy pair of flip-flops. A bathing suit is naturally a must! However, rethink the fancy bling; it’s best left at home. Also, forget a bulky blow dryer - most resorts provide them. And unless you intend to do serious trekking in the jungle , heavy outdoor footwear are not required.

Don't Waste Space! What Not to Bring to Cancun
Planning a trip to the Yucatan ? Fantastic! But before you load your suitcase , consider what you *don't* need. Seriously , many things take up valuable room and can easily be acquired in Cancun. For copyrightple, heavy beach towels are often provided by your hotel , and you can always pick up a cheap one locally if you really need it. Similarly, high-end toiletries are readily accessible at local stores. Here's a quick look of things you can probably leave behind :
- Heavy clothing – the climate is hot !
- Several pairs of boots – you'll mostly be in flip-flops .
- Added electronics – enjoy the sun !
- Complete first-aid kits – pharmacies are readily accessible.
- Formal attire – unless you have special plans.
Remember that less is more will make your experience so much enjoyable!
